The home of sport in Geelong – GMHBA Stadium. Originally built in 1941, GMHBA Stadium is the heart and soul of Geelong and is home to the Australian Football League (AFL) team, the Geelong Cats. An upgrade to the stadium lighting has also bolstered the venue’s capabilities, with AFL night games and Big Bash Cricket now also hosted at the Geelong venue. GMHBA Stadium has a capacity of 36,000 and has played host to National A-League and W-League soccer, Super Rugby, Super Motorcycles and domestic first-class cricket matches.
